Average Sales Engineers Salary in Arizona

Sales Engineers in Arizona command an impressive average annual salary of $174,450, substantially exceeding the national average of $130,420. This elevated compensation is likely driven by Arizona's robust technology sector and a demand for specialized technical sales expertise that outpaces national trends.

Executive Summary

  • Average Salary: $174,450 per year.
  •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 26.9% over the last 5 years.
  •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$229,600.
  • Outlook: With a local workforce of 1,220 Sales Engineers and a Location Quotient of 1.04, Arizona demonstrates a healthy concentration of these professionals, indicating a stable and potentially growing job market. The presence of nearly the national average concentration suggests consistent demand and opportunities for skilled individuals in the state.

The nominal average salary of $174,450 in Arizona presents a strong purchasing power, even with a Cost of Living Index of 106.4, which is only slightly above the national average. This means that while expenses are marginally higher than the national benchmark, the substantial salary advantage allows Sales Engineers to maintain a high standard of living and potentially save more.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 1,220 employees in the Arizona area with a job density of 0.383 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
